Search on:Ability to Repay (ATR) requires that a lender make a reasonable, good-faith determination before or when consummating a mortgage loan that the consumer has a reasonable ability to repay the loan, considering such factors as the consumer�s income or assets and employment status

Process of reviewing that the Lender information is accurately listed as the Mortgage Loss Payee on each of the subject property's insurance policies. The addition of the loss payee clause helps protect the Lender from loss, after closing, in the event the subject property is damaged by a covered event.

Process of calculating the minimum required amount of any insurance required by the Lender based on loan amount, dwelling replacement costs, or environmental factors. The Lender confirms the Borrower has obtained sufficient coverage on each policy to meet the Lender's minimum coverage and deductible requirements.

Documentation or information that must exist (""be satisfied"") at or before a point in the origination process, such as Prior to Closing, Prior to Funding, etc. Common conditions include proof of mortgage insurance (when applicable), proof of homeowners insurance, and requests for additional documentation.
